If your TSH and Free T4 are normal, then your thyroid function is considered normal (euthyroid) — even if Total T4 is low. A low Total T4 alone does NOT cause weight gain and usually reflects low thyroid-binding proteins, not low thyroid hormone activity. This means: • Your cells are getting adequate thyroid hormone • Increasing Total T4 will not help with weight loss • Thyroid medication is NOT indicated based on this pattern Rapid weight gain from 2023 is unlikely due to thyroid if TSH and FT4 are normal. More common causes include: • Insulin resistance • Stress / cortisol excess • Sleep disturbance • Dietary changes • Perimenopause / hormonal shifts (if applicable)
Next Steps
(Recommended Tests) • TSH + Free T4 (repeat if not recent) • Fasting insulin / HOMA-IR • Lipid profile • Vitamin D, B12 • Cortisol (if stress symptoms are significant)
Health Tips
What Actually Helps Weight Control • Focus on insulin sensitivity, not thyroid numbers • Adequate protein intake • Resistance training • Stress management and sleep regulation ⸻

If your TSH and Free T4 are consistently normal, a low Total T4 alone usually does not indicate hypothyroidism and is often due to low thyroid-binding proteins (like TBG), lab variation, illness, or medications. In such cases, thyroid hormone action in the body is normal, and weight gain is unlikely to be caused by low Total T4.
Next Steps
Focus on confirming thyroid status with TSH + Free T4 (± Free T3) rather than Total T4. Evaluate other causes of weight gain such as insulin resistance, diet changes, reduced activity, sleep issues, stress, cortisol excess, or medications.
Health Tips
There is no safe or recommended way to increase Total T4 if TSH and Free T4 are normal—taking thyroid medicines in this setting can be harmful. Avoid unnecessary supplements claiming to “boost thyroid.”

If TSH and Free T4 are normal, thyroid hormone is NOT the cause of weight gain.Your thyroid function is likely normal. Weight gain is almost certainly due to non-thyroid metabolic or lifestyle factors, and increasing Total T4 is neither necessary nor safe.feel free to consult me on practo for further guidance and evaluation.
